It might make sense to move this git repository to the Debian git service https://salsa.debian.org/, where it will be easier to get help from the Debian QA infrastructure and Debian developers.

Steffan proposed it, and I agree that it might be a good choice. The advantages is that the git repository will be tracked by the Debian Janitor system, which report (and some time commit) issues that should be fixed in the packaging, like dependencies changing names.

I suspect it might make sense to place it into one of the existing teams in Debian, and my proposal is the Science team which already contain freecad, opencamlib and other packages related to linuxcnc. An disadvantage with such team maintenance is that the 'maintainer' field in debian/control will be the mailing list for that team, and any Debian bugs reported will be sent to that mailing list instead of the LinuxCNC developer team.

As far as I can tell, me, Steffen and Sebastian are already members of the Science team in Debian. I am sure Andy and others can become members too.
